The SECO 03280035 is a solid carbide turning insert in the WNMG-M3 series, designed for high-performance metal cutting operations including boring, facing, and turning. It carries the industry standard designation WNMG433-M3 and ISO code WNMG080412-M3. The insert features a CVD-applied Duratomic multilayer coating of TiCN, Al2O3, and Cr, delivering wear resistance and thermal stability during interrupted and continuous cuts. The 80-degree trigon shape with a neutral hand orientation and a chamfered and honed cutting edge style make this insert suitable for a range of stock removal applications. It is installed by machinists and tool-room technicians working on CNC lathes and turning centers.
This insert is primarily specified for stainless steel (ISO material code M, material grades M30 and M40) and secondarily for steel (ISO material code P). Typical applications include external and internal turning, facing passes, and boring operations on both manual and CNC turning equipment. The M3 chip breaker geometry is optimized for medium cutting conditions common in production machining environments. The insert accepts clamp, pin, and lever-lock holding methods, giving shops flexibility across toolholder systems they already run.
Designed for use in WNMG-style toolholders that accept clamp, pin, or lever-lock insert retention. Primary workpiece material is stainless steel (ISO M); secondary workpiece material is steel (ISO P). Multi-use application across boring, facing, and turning operations.
Installation is performed by qualified machinists or tool-room technicians. Power down and lock out the machine spindle before indexing or replacing inserts. Seat the insert fully against the toolholder pocket before tightening the clamp, pin, or lever-lock mechanism to manufacturer-specified torque using the appropriate torque wrench or key. Inspect the cutting edge and chip breaker for damage before each use; a chipped or worn edge on a carbide insert should be indexed or replaced, not reused.
